Output e2e614c8f6925314682d5235171ad770cc39832ef6da8ffcf2fd2f2fafd53693:23

value
38000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09c162f34027a6b1c26df39ee8d5a2b9e1b3ed56 OP_EQUAL
address
32abg13GeUjVbhaWoLs3sPYRQKsr3Tsn7H
transaction
e2e614c8f6925314682d5235171ad770cc39832ef6da8ffcf2fd2f2fafd53693
confirmations
413030
spent
true